HIP 110708
HIP 110708 is a K-type (Orange) star.
At a distance of roughly 1,469 light-years, HIP 110708 is a distant star lying deep within the Milky Way galaxy.
HIP 110708 is classified as a spectral class K star (K-type (Orange)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.
HIP 110708 has an apparent magnitude of +8.37,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its yellow h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.984.
